WebTypically a sleeve gastrectomy procedure can be performed as an overnight-stay surgery and involves removing a large portion – about 75 to 80 percent – of the stomach. The remaining portion of the stomach is formed into a slender tube which is unable to enlarge or balloon up with food. Large five-year studies show the LSG to be as effective ... WebPrimary procedures included gastric banding (LAGB), Sleeve gastrectomy (SG), vertical banded gastroplasty (VBG) and gastric plication. The mean age was 43.1 years and female to male ratio was 3.04: 1. The body mass index (BMI) at primary procedure was 47.05 kg/m 2. The mean BMI at revisional surgery was 41.6 kg/m 2 (range 28-70.8).
